The tool is otherwise knows as the Uni-syn, any VW parts house should have a pile of them. I used one to calibrate my DRLA dellortos on my Manx. It takes a little doing but I will have to second the Dellorto tech book being invaluable as a resource. These carbs are awesome once dialed in correctly.

CB Performance has it all. They are big on VW stuff but the book covers downdraft carbs in good detail, you can also source jets, venturis etc. from CB and on ebay.
